Why We Need Solar Powered Air Conditioners?

The need for solar-powered air conditioners is vital considering how according to energy.gov, three-quarters of homes in the US use air conditioning which consumes about 6% of total electricity usage costing $29 billion annually and releasing 117 million metric tons of carbon dioxide! Switching to solar powered energy-efficient air conditioning can help decrease the load from the environment and save considerable amounts of money.

 

Currently, as of 2020, solar energy only accounts for 2.4% of total electricity use. Switching towards solar powered central air conditioning or installing solar powered window or portable air conditioners can be a great step towards fighting the current climate crisis.

 

How Does a Solar AC Work?

A solar air conditioner combines solar electricity and air conditioning. In simple words, it takes energy from the Sun and uses it to power your AC to cool your space!

 

A solar panel is a device that captures the power of the Sun. It converts the Sun rays into electrical energy. This energy can then be used directly or stored in a battery. This is known as DC power. A solar-powered air conditioner then uses this DC power, either directly as DC or after conversion into AC (using an inverter), and heats or cools your home. Instead of using grid energy, a solar-powered air conditioner uses the energy of the Sun. It can use the grid energy, though, if needed.

 

The solar AC units collects energy in two ways: photovoltaic (PV) systems or solar thermal systems. Solar PV systems use photovoltaic panels to generate electricity, while solar thermal systems work like solar water heaters. They use up the sun’s energy to heat up water which then changes the refrigerant into a heat-absorbing gas that provides air-conditioned air to your home.
